METHOD OF MAKING A MASK WITH CUSTOMIZED FACIAL FEATURES
First Claim
1. A method of making a mask of a subject'"'"'s face having a shape adapted to interfit with a corresponding mask-receiving portion on a head, the method comprising:
- obtaining at least 3D image data of the subject'"'"'s face;
computer processing the 3D image data using facial feature recognition software to identify preselected facial landmarks in the 3D image data;
aligning the image represented by the 3D image data with a mask model using at least one of the identified preselected facial landmarks;
projecting the perimeter of the aligned mask model on the aligned image represented by 3-D image data;
trimming the image represented by the 3D image data to the projected perimeter of the aligned mask model;
bending the edge portions of the image represented by the 3D image data to manage the gap between the edge perimeter of the image represented by the 3D image and the edge perimeter of the mask model;
generating image data to fill the gap between the edge perimeter of the image represented by the 3D image and the edge perimeter of the mask model,and mating the image represented by the 3D image data to a mask data set.
